+/* libdwarfdefs.h
+*/
+
+#ifndef LIBDWARFDEFS_H
+#define LIBDWARFDEFS_H
+
+/* We want __uint32_t and __uint64_t and __int32_t __int64_t
+ properly defined but not duplicated, since duplicate typedefs
+ are not legal C.
+*/
+/*
+ HAVE___UINT32_T
+ HAVE___UINT64_T will be set by configure if
+ our 4 types are predefined in compiler
+*/
+
+
+#if (!defined(HAVE___UINT32_T)) && defined(HAVE___UINT32_T_IN_SGIDEFS_H)
+#include <sgidefs.h> /* sgidefs.h defines them */
+#define HAVE___UINT32_T 1
+#endif
+
+#if (!defined(HAVE___UINT64_T)) && defined(HAVE___UINT64_T_IN_SGIDEFS_H)
+#include <sgidefs.h> /* sgidefs.h defines them */
+#define HAVE___UINT64_T 1
+#endif
+
+
+#if (!defined(HAVE___UINT32_T)) && \
+ defined(HAVE_SYS_TYPES_H) && \
+ defined(HAVE___UINT32_T_IN_SYS_TYPES_H)
+# include <sys/types.h>
+#define HAVE___UINT32_T 1
+#endif
+
+#if (!defined(HAVE___UINT64_T)) && \
+ defined(HAVE_SYS_TYPES_H) && \
+ defined(HAVE___UINT64_T_IN_SYS_TYPES_H)
+# include <sys/types.h>
+#define HAVE___UINT64_T 1
+#endif
+
+#ifndef HAVE___UINT32_T
+typedef int __int32_t;
+typedef unsigned __uint32_t;
+#define HAVE___UINT32_T 1
+#endif
+
+#ifndef HAVE___UINT64_T
+typedef long long __int64_t;
+typedef unsigned long long __uint64_t;
+#define HAVE___UINT64_T 1
+#endif
+
+#endif /* LIBDWARFDEFS_H */
